Output 7622fb1e34359ce3178c368b122b46632ea37002dc6fea2a16c8fea6b4cef09d:39

value
599990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6381c20030384d94b28c3e7f98eba05a70dbca19 OP_EQUAL
address
3AmAGGPC51U3HVHK73FpsyGaGY51y7x5Rg
transaction
7622fb1e34359ce3178c368b122b46632ea37002dc6fea2a16c8fea6b4cef09d
spent
true